Final EIA Report completed

Wind Prower Plant Imret project is split into two parts for the environmental permitting purposes. Part 1, consisting of 23 confirmed and 6 reserve positions is attributed 85 MW and Part 2, consisting of 4 confirmed and 1 reserve positions is attributed 15 MW. USAID Energy Program

USAID Energy Program (UEP) is a $7.5 million 3-year project aimed at supporting Georgia in energy market development per Georgia’s obligations under the Energy Community Treaty. The ultimate goal of this program is to enhance Georgia’s energy security through improved legal and regulatory framework and increased investments in the energy sector. UEP will build the […]
